On January 31, 2022, I arrived at the Optum Adult Clinic at Journal Center to check in for my appointment to get prescription refills, and I coughed. It was a small clearing-throat cough but the desk clerk Alice asked if I had COVID symptoms. I said no, that I was asthmatic and had had a cold two weeks before. She told me I needed to be tested anyway and rudely demanded that I get back in my car and park in a weird side lot. When I expressed confusion, she threatened to cancel my doctor’s appointment. Ten minutes later, a medical assistant Sharon walked outside and shoved the swab up my nose so hard it made my nose bleed. She half apologized saying, “I didn’t even push in the swab as far as I should have.” Thirty-five minutes later I got a call on my cell phone, “You can come in now.” When I finally saw the doctor a hour after my appointment, he said he thought I was a no-show because no one told him I was getting a COVID test. He also said the desk clerk should never have ordered the test because she isn’t a medical professional. Never in my left have I been treated so disrespectfully by a medical establishment. This experience clearly demonstrates the profound lack of professionalism by Optum and the extreme dysfunction of health care in Albuquerque.
